Actyally the Yammy skis get a bad rap. It's more in the rubber bumper under the spindle that causes the problem. I put a plastic toilet shim (the wedge shaped ones) under the back side of the bumper which raises the front of the keel about 1/4" off the snow and no more darting. I used form a gasket and a brass screw to secure it to the rubber. There has been a lot of talk over at Totally Yamaha about shim mods being the cheap fix for darting. Makes for a completely different machine.
